Entertainment Law

The firm's Entertainment Law practice, headed by Michael B. Kent, provides comprehensive counseling services, and negotiating and preparing organizational and transactional agreements for musical groups, independent record labels, management, and production and music publishing companies. The Entertainment Law group also negotiates video production, event sponsorship and merchandising agreements, athlete and celebrity endorsement and appearance agreements, intellectual property rights licenses and, with KB&G's Litigation Department, aggressively protects its client's rights by litigating contract and intellectual property rights disputes. KB&G counts among its clients accomplished songwriters and recording and performing artists, including Academy Award® and Grammy® Award winners, as well as recording studio designers, literary artists and agents, electronic publishers, and print, photo and other media artists.
